




I recently tested the EU 8-Position Multifunctional Socket Tower to see if its vertical design could truly manage a complex workstation. This device effectively organizes multiple plugs and USB-powered peripherals into a single, compact footprint.
The construction feels solid, with a sturdy base that prevents tipping even when fully loaded with bulky adapters. The inclusion of independent switches for each position is a major plus for durability, as it reduces wear and tear from constantly plugging and unplugging devices.
Setting up the tower is straightforward, and it significantly reduced the cable spaghetti under my desk almost immediately. While the USB ports are strictly for power rather than data, they provide a reliable, always-on connection for desk lamps, fans, and mobile accessories.
